Apple/Malus – Braeburn

Description

This highly-flavored, late-season apple originated in New Zealand. Braeburn’s excellent flavor is rich and aromatic. Medium-to-large fruit is oval in shape. The flesh is cream color, firm, very crisp and juicy. The tree is moderately vigorous and crops heavily. Pollinator required: Choose another apple variety. See recommended pollinators below.

Excellent for snacking, cooking, sauces, and salads

Height/Width: Varies (estimated 12 – 15′ tall)
Harvest: Mid-September
Exposure: Full Sun
Zone: 4-8
